< návrat zpět

MS Excel


Téma: Hromadné přejmenování souborů na základě seznamu rss

Zaslal/a 14.3.2015 10:06

Dobrý den,
chtěl bych požádat o pomoc při vytvoření makra na hromadné přejmenování souborů ve složce (většinou se bude jednat o pdf soubory nebo obrázkové soubory na základě seznamu, který mám v excelu)
Je toto možné nějak zautomatizovat? Přepisovat ručně název třeba 1000 souborů je dosti pracné.
Předem děkuji za radu.

Příloha: zip24118_wall-dotaz.zip (6kB, staženo 65x)
Zaslat odpověď >

Strana:  « předchozí  1 2
#031929
avatar
Tyjo, když pouřívám tu tvojí tabulku, tak mi to přejmenovat nejde, píše mi to ignor, nebo jednou to hodilo error, nevím proč. Nevíš co s tím? :Dcitovat
#031931
elninoslov
Keď nemám žiadnu prílohu, žiadne dáta ako príklad, žiadny podrobnejší popis (súbory sú/niesú na sieti...), tak fakt neviem. Je to už môj starý kód, dnes by som robil niektoré veci inak. Ale ako ho skúšam - funguje. Takže ... ?citovat
#043229
avatar
Ahoj.
Potrebujem podla listu zmenit a nakopirovat rozne nazvy pre jeden jpg subor.

Cestu mam, stare nazvy mam, nove nazvy mam a pise mi ignor.

Co robim zle?

Excel:
Cesta k súboru Starý názov säboru St.príp. Nový názov súboru Nov.príp. Zmena Výsledok
C:\premen 129m (1) jpg 2376M jpg IGNOR
C:\premen 129m (10) jpg 238M jpg IGNOR
C:\premen 129m (100) jpg 23801M jpg IGNOR
C:\premen 129m (101) jpg 240M jpg IGNOR
C:\premen 129m (102) jpg 242M jpg IGNOR
C:\premen 129m (103) jpg 243M jpg IGNOR
C:\premen 129m (104) jpg 24304M jpg IGNOR
C:\premen 129m (105) jpg 244M jpg IGNOR
C:\premen 129m (106) jpg 24503M jpg IGNORcitovat
#043230
elninoslov
Keď prídem a bude sa mi chcieť, vyskúšam nasimulovať. Ale ak je to skutočne rovno pod C:\ tak vidím problém v prístupových právach. Windows totiž väčšinou požaduje práva správcu na priamy prístup do koreňu C:\. Skúste to dať do nejakého adresáru napr. C:\Pokus\citovat
#043235
elninoslov
Priamo na C:\ dostanete chybu "Permission denied", čo je presne to, čo som spomínal. V Roote iného disku je to OK. Ale tento prípad obmedzených práv vráti výsledok "ERROR". Výsleodk "IGNOR" by mal nastať v prípade, ak nový názov = starý názov. Čo máte v stĺpci "Zmena" ?
Ak to nieje priamo Root "C:\" ale je to "C:\premen" - bez lomítka na konci, tak to musí dať "ERROR".
Priložte súbor, kde máte presne vyplnené dáta, a presnú adresárovú štruktúru (súbory neposielajte, len štruktúru, ja si súbory vytvorím).

Budem musieť na to asi niekedy lepšie pozrieť, a možno aj prepracovať logiku.citovat
#043238
kabaka
Použila som poslednú verziu.
Pri premenovaní súborov z xls na xlsx nebol problém.

Ale pri premenovaní z doc na docx mi word vykázal chybu. Nechcel otvoriť dokument.
Keď som ich znovu premenovala na doc, bolo ich možné otvoriť.citovat
#043239
elninoslov
Primárne je to určené samozrejme na premenovanie súborov, nie na zmenu prípony, čo vo väčšine prípadov znamená nutnosť konverzie súboru na daný typ. A to sa asi deje u Wordu. DOC nieje DOCX, je to iná štruktúra dokumentu. To že to Word dokáže otvoriť viac druhov súborov, je tak naprogramované, to neznamená, že sú súbory rovnaké. Podobnosť XLS a XLSX je
a) asi väčšia ako Doc vs. Docx
b) alebo je Excel naprogramovaný tak, že si sám zistí bez ohľadu na príponu Xls/Xlsx, podľa štruktúry súboru, ako ho má spracovať.
Tomuto sa vôbec nemôžete čudovať.citovat
#054209
avatar
elninoslov: Perfektní. Díky moccitovat

Strana:  « předchozí  1 2

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je